Meet Archibald, 1885

Archibald is a Pureling™ hare, and he is no ordinary hare.

Pureling™ hares can grow to nearly three and a half feet tall when standing on their hind legs. They are strong, quick-witted, and built for life in the New Beginning. Their proper food is simple: clover and fresh new grass.

But the most remarkable thing about a Pureling™ hare isn’t its size.

They are from the Beginning.

Purelings™ are pure, without knowledge of the world or the fears, doubts, and troubles that come with it. They know only what belongs to the Beginning, unless they become worldly-wise.

And that is when everything can change.

They can talk.

Archibald speaks freely with people and other beings, and he has a way of saying exactly what he thinks. He is curious, cheerful, and completely untroubled by things that might frighten a human.

Archibald doesn’t know what it means to be afraid.

Pureling™ Hare Facts

Height: Up to 3½ feet tall on their hind legs
Proper food: Clover and fresh new grass
Special ability: Speech
Kind: Pureling
From: The Beginning

In the novel, Archibald is the focal point of his kind, but he is not the only Pureling™ hare. Many others of his kind must also reach the New Beginning to remain Purelings.
